Master SEO Monitoring: Use Analytics to Track and Improve Performance
SEO monitoring through analytics turns guesswork into clear, actionable insights—helping you spot crawl errors, speed bottlenecks, and content gaps before they hurt traffic. This article walks site owners and developers through the technical principles, tools, and practical steps to build a resilient monitoring workflow that boosts organic performance.
Effective search engine optimization (SEO) is no longer a one-time checklist; it requires continuous monitoring, analysis, and iterative improvement. For site owners, developers, and businesses aiming to maintain or increase organic traffic, mastering SEO monitoring through analytics is essential. This article explains the technical principles behind SEO monitoring, practical implementation techniques, common application scenarios, comparative advantages of different monitoring approaches, and actionable guidance for selecting infrastructure and tools to support robust SEO analytics workflows.
Fundamental Principles of SEO Monitoring
At its core, SEO monitoring involves tracking indicators that reflect how well a website satisfies search engines and user intent. These indicators fall into three technical domains: technical SEO, on-page SEO, and off-page signals.
Technical SEO Metrics
- Crawlability and Indexability — Monitor crawl errors, sitemap status, and robots.txt interpretations via server logs and tools like Google Search Console (GSC). Server logs allow you to verify which URLs search engine bots request and how often. Parsing logs with tools such as GoAccess, AWStats, or custom scripts (Python + regex) helps identify blocked resources, redirect chains, and soft 404s.
- Site Performance — Page speed and Core Web Vitals (LCP, FID/INP, CLS) directly affect rankings and user experience. Use synthetic tests (Lighthouse, WebPageTest) and field data (Chrome UX Report) to measure metrics. Instrument pages with the Web Vitals JavaScript library to collect real user metrics (RUM) aggregated in analytics pipelines.
- HTTPS and Security — TLS configuration, HSTS, and mixed-content issues can impact indexing. Periodic automated scans (SSL Labs, custom OpenSSL checks) and header inspections ensure secure delivery.
- Structured Data — Validate schema markup with GSC and structured-data testing tools to ensure rich results eligibility.
On-Page and Content Metrics
- Keyword Rankings and SERP Features — Track keyword positions, impression share, and presence in featured snippets or knowledge panels. Combine data from GSC (queries, CTR) with third-party rank trackers for cross-validation.
- Content Quality Signals — Engagement metrics like bounce rate, time on page, and scroll depth (captured in Google Analytics or self-hosted analytics) reveal whether content meets user intent. Use event tracking and custom dimensions to segment behavior by traffic source and landing page.
Off-Page Signals and Backlinks
- Backlink Profile — Monitor referring domains, anchor text distribution, and link growth/decay using tools like Ahrefs, Majestic, or Moz. Combine crawled data with indexation status to ensure high-value links are recognized by search engines.
- Brand Mentions and Social Signals — Track unlinked brand mentions through web crawlers and mention APIs; integrate with analytics to measure referral traffic uplift.
Implementing an SEO Monitoring Stack
Designing a monitoring stack requires combining data sources, processing pipelines, and visualization/reporting. Below is a practical architecture that balances fidelity and operational cost.
Data Sources and Collection
- Google Search Console API — Programmatically fetch query-level impressions, clicks, CTR, and average position. Use it to build daily/weekly trend reports and detect drops quickly.
- Google Analytics / GA4 — Capture behavioral metrics, conversion paths, and landing-page performance. Use Measurement Protocol or GTM for server-side event collection to reduce signal loss.
- Server Logs — Stream or batch-process logs (Apache/Nginx) to identify bot activity and crawl frequency. Use tools like Elastic Stack (Elasticsearch, Logstash, Kibana) or cloud analytics for scalable indexing and querying.
- Third-party Crawlers — Use site crawlers (Screaming Frog, Sitebulb) for periodic audits of broken links, metadata, and duplicate content.
- RUM and Synthetic Monitoring — Combine field data (Web Vitals JS) with scheduled synthetic tests (Lighthouse CI, WebPageTest) for comprehensive performance coverage.
Processing and Storage
- Ingest raw data into a central store: a data warehouse (BigQuery, ClickHouse, PostgreSQL) or an ELK stack depending on query patterns.
- Process large datasets using batch or stream frameworks (Airflow, cron jobs, or serverless functions) to compute derived metrics (e.g., rolling averages, anomaly scores).
- Implement retention policies and data sampling for high-traffic sites to control storage costs while preserving actionable insights.
Visualization and Alerting
- Dashboards: Grafana, Looker Studio, or Kibana to visualize trends, correlations (e.g., page speed vs. rankings), and segment performance.
- Alerting: Integrate anomaly detection (statistical or ML-based) to trigger notifications on traffic drops, indexation regressions, or Core Web Vitals degradation. Use email, Slack, or PagerDuty for alerts.
Application Scenarios and Best Practices
The technical approach to SEO monitoring varies with business goals. Here are common scenarios and recommended practices.
Large Content Portals
- Focus on automated crawl monitoring and content quality pipelines. Use log analysis to prioritize pages for optimization based on crawl frequency and traffic potential.
- Implement content testing (A/B or multivariate) to iteratively improve title tags, meta descriptions, and structured data targeting.
E-commerce Sites
- Monitor product page performance, canonicalization, and faceted navigation to avoid duplicate content. Use server-side rendering or dynamic rendering patterns where necessary to ensure indexation of JS-heavy pages.
- Track conversion rates by organic landing pages and normalize for seasonality. Tie analytics to inventory and pricing systems to understand business impact.
Technical SEO for Developers
- Embed SEO checks into CI/CD pipelines: Lighthouse CI, HTMLProofer, and schema validation can run as part of builds to block regressions before deployment.
- Use feature flags and canary releases to measure SEO impact of UI or structural changes incrementally.
Comparative Advantages of Monitoring Approaches
Different monitoring strategies have trade-offs in cost, accuracy, and required expertise.
- Server Log Analysis vs. GSC — Server logs provide raw, bot-level insight and are more immediate (no sampling), but require storage and parsing infrastructure. GSC provides valuable query-level data and indexation feedback but is subject to limitations and sometimes delayed reporting.
- Field Data vs. Synthetic Tests — Field data (RUM) reflects real users and diverse environments, which is essential for Core Web Vitals. Synthetic testing is repeatable and controllable, ideal for regression testing and optimization experiments.
- Third-party Tools vs. In-house Stack — Third-party platforms accelerate setup and include specialized capabilities (backlink analysis, rank tracking) but incur ongoing fees. In-house stacks provide flexibility and cost control at scale but require engineering resources.
Infrastructure and Selection Advice
A performant and reliable hosting environment underpins accurate monitoring and SEO performance. Consider the following technical factors when choosing infrastructure:
- Latency and Geographic Presence — Host content close to your target audience to reduce Time To First Byte (TTFB). Use edge CDN for static assets and consider region-specific VPS to improve local crawl and user experience.
- Resource Isolation — A VPS with dedicated CPU and memory reduces noisy neighbor effects that can skew performance measurements compared to shared hosting.
- Scalability and Automation — Choose a provider that supports API-driven provisioning, snapshots, and automated scaling to handle traffic spikes during promotions or crawler activity.
- Security and Compliance — Ensure TLS, WAF options, and backups to maintain uptime and trust signals for search engines.
For example, deploying analytics processing components (Elasticsearch, ClickHouse, or a logging pipeline) on a reliable virtual private server can ensure consistent performance for log ingestion and dashboard queries. When selecting a VPS, evaluate network throughput, I/O performance for storage-intensive tasks, and available datacenter regions.
Practical Implementation Checklist
- Configure Google Search Console and link it with Google Analytics/GA4.
- Set up server log collection and automate parsing into your analytics store.
- Implement Web Vitals RUM collection and synthetic Lighthouse tests.
- Schedule site crawls and integrate results with issue trackers for prioritized fixes.
- Create dashboards for executive and technical audiences, and establish alerting thresholds for critical SEO KPIs.
- Archive historical benchmarks to detect long-term trends versus short-term volatility.
Consistent monitoring and a data-driven approach allow teams to detect regressions early, quantify the impact of technical changes, and prioritize SEO work by expected return.
Conclusion
Mastering SEO monitoring requires combining diverse data sources—server logs, search console metrics, behavioral analytics, performance telemetry, and backlink data—into a coherent analytics workflow. For developers and site owners, embedding monitoring into CI/CD, using both field and synthetic testing, and deploying on reliable infrastructure provide the technical foundation to sustain and improve organic performance.
For those looking to deploy analytics and processing services on dependable infrastructure, consider a VPS that offers solid network performance, resource isolation, and flexible region choices. Learn more about VPS.DO’s offerings and available regions, including their USA VPS, which can be a practical option for hosting analytics stacks, logging pipelines, and web services supporting SEO monitoring workflows. For general information about the provider, visit VPS.DO.